Identifying the Dress: Your First Step
Before you can find the dress, it’s essential to gather as much information as possible. The more details you have, the easier your search will be. Start by identifying key characteristics such as:
- Style: Is it a maxi, midi, or mini dress? Is it a bodycon, A-line, or sheath dress? Knowing the style will significantly narrow down your options.
- Color and Print: What color is the dress? Does it have a print, like floral, polka dots, or stripes? Specific details like these can make or break your search.
- Fabric: Is it made of silk, cotton, linen, or a synthetic blend? The fabric can influence the dress's drape and overall look.
- Details: Does it have any unique features, such as lace, ruffles, beading, or a special neckline? These details can be crucial in your search.
Once you've gathered these details, you can start your search more effectively. This foundational step ensures that you're not just aimlessly browsing, but rather actively seeking a dress with defined characteristics. Online Retailers: Your Digital Dress Destination
Online retailers are a treasure trove of dresses, offering a vast selection of styles, sizes, and price points. Here are some of the best places to start your search:
- Major Department Stores: Websites like Nordstrom, Macy's, and Bloomingdale's often have a wide range of dresses from various brands. Their search filters allow you to narrow down options by size, color, style, and price.
- Fashion Retailers: ASOS, H&M, Zara, and Mango are great options for trendy and affordable dresses. They frequently update their inventory, so you'll always find something new.
- Specialty Boutiques: Sites like Revolve, Shopbop, and Net-a-Porter curate collections from both established and emerging designers. If you're looking for something unique or high-end, these are excellent places to explore.
- Online Marketplaces: Don't forget about marketplaces like Etsy and Amazon. Etsy is perfect for handmade and vintage dresses, while Amazon offers a huge selection from various sellers.
When searching online, use specific keywords related to the dress's style, color, and details. For example, if you're looking for a long-sleeved floral maxi dress, type that into the search bar. Be patient and persistent; the perfect dress is out there, waiting to be discovered.
Online retailers often have detailed product descriptions and customer reviews, which can provide valuable insights into the fit and quality of the dress. Make sure to read these reviews and check the size charts before making a purchase. Remember, finding the right fit is just as important as finding the right style.
Image Search: Let Visuals Lead the Way
One of the most effective ways to find a dress is through image search. If you have a picture of the dress you're looking for, you can upload it to Google Images, Pinterest, or other visual search engines. These tools use image recognition technology to find visually similar dresses online.
- Google Images: Simply go to Google Images, click the camera icon in the search bar, and upload your image. Google will show you visually similar images and websites where the dress might be available.
- Pinterest: Pinterest's visual search tool is particularly useful for fashion. Upload your image, and Pinterest will display similar pins and products.
- ASOS Image Search: ASOS has its own image search tool within its app, allowing you to find similar items directly on their platform.
Image search is a game-changer when you have a clear visual of the dress you want. It eliminates the need to describe the dress in words, making the search process much more efficient. Plus, it can lead you to unexpected discoveries, such as similar styles you might not have considered.
Social Media: The Fashion Finder's Paradise
Social media platforms like Instagram and TikTok are goldmines for discovering new fashion trends and finding specific dresses. Many fashion bloggers and influencers showcase outfits and tag the brands they're wearing. Here's how to leverage social media in your search:
- Follow Fashion Influencers: Look for influencers who share your style and regularly feature dresses. Pay attention to their posts and stories, as they often link directly to the products they're wearing.
- Use Hashtags: Search for relevant hashtags like #dress, #fashion, #ootd (outfit of the day), and specific dress styles like #maxidress or #cocktaildress. This will help you discover posts featuring dresses you might like.
- Engage with Brands: Follow your favorite clothing brands on social media. They often post new arrivals and run contests where you can win dresses.
- Instagram Shopping: Instagram's shopping feature allows you to buy products directly from posts. Look for the shopping bag icon on posts and explore tagged items.
Social media is not just a platform for inspiration; it's a powerful tool for discovery and connection. By engaging with fashion influencers and brands, you can stay up-to-date on the latest trends and find the dresses you've been dreaming of.
Local Boutiques: The Charm of In-Person Shopping
While online shopping offers convenience and variety, don't underestimate the charm and personalized experience of local boutiques. Shopping in person allows you to try on dresses, feel the fabric, and get expert styling advice.
- Independent Boutiques: These stores often carry unique and hard-to-find pieces. Take some time to explore the boutiques in your area; you might be surprised at what you discover.
- Consignment Shops: Consignment shops are a great place to find designer dresses at discounted prices. You might stumble upon a hidden gem that's perfect for you.
- Department Store Personal Shoppers: Many department stores offer personal shopping services. A stylist can help you find dresses that suit your body type and personal style.
Shopping at local boutiques supports small businesses and provides a more intimate shopping experience. The personal touch of boutique shopping can make all the difference, especially when you're looking for something special. Plus, you can often find dresses that you won't see everyone else wearing.
Tailoring and Alterations: The Key to a Perfect Fit
Sometimes, finding the perfect dress isn't just about the style; it's about the fit. Even the most beautiful dress won't look its best if it doesn't fit properly. Tailoring and alterations can transform an okay dress into a stunning one.
- Find a Good Tailor: Look for a tailor with experience in dress alterations. Ask for recommendations from friends or read online reviews.
- Common Alterations: Common alterations include hemming the length, taking in the sides, adjusting the straps, and adding or removing sleeves.
- Customization: Tailoring can also be used to customize a dress. For example, you could add embellishments, change the neckline, or create a unique silhouette.
A well-tailored dress not only looks better but also feels more comfortable. Don't hesitate to invest in alterations; they can make a world of difference in how you look and feel in your dress.
